What is AgSafe?
AgSafe operates as a specialized service provider dedicated to the agricultural industry, offering a comprehensive suite of safety training, human resources support, and labor relations expertise. The company addresses the unique operational challenges faced by farm labor contractors and agricultural employers by delivering tailored safety audits, program reviews, and compliance-focused training modules. Through its member portal and strategic partnerships, AgSafe facilitates a culture of safety that helps organizations mitigate risk and adhere to stringent regulatory requirements. By bridging the gap between complex labor laws and field-level execution, the firm has established itself as an essential resource for modern, safety-conscious agricultural enterprises.
